[This file should have been committed with the other
rf_enableAtomicRMW changes.] Cleanup rf_enableAtomicRMW and its use. According to the comments, we can't set this to anything other than zero anyway. Shaves off another 900 bytes. lu_flag's days are numbered now, as are the middle parameters of RF_CREATE_PARAM3.
